Some of the natives collect and put up salmon when they are that far along in the spawning, particularly the sockeyes (reds). I have not had spawned out salmon. Frankly, I don't care for salmon at all. But friends who otherwise like salmon say they don't care for it when they are this far along. Again, it's more of a native thing. They're still fun to catch though.
